Auburn University has a tradition of winning football. Still, over the past few years, it has not only failed to post a winning season but also failed to make an appearance in the College Football Playoff, unlike its SEC rivals.

One of their biggest supporters is former NFL MVP Cam Newton. Newton won a Heisman Trophy and a national championship while at Auburn.

But like many fans of the program, Newton has grown tired of losing and now says he refuses to support it financially until they start winning again.

“If they ain’t about winning, they can get out of my face and go back to where they came from. I’m tired of supporting something that’s not winning! Can you deliver that message to the parents? Especially to the parents. Before they ask for money, WE. WANT. WINNERS. That’s our restitution. We give you money, you give us wins, and if you don’t. CTRL. ALT. DELETE," Newton said while at a recent event.

As new Auburn head coach Alex Golesh has stated, he intends to bring back former players like Newton to the program, but Newton has made it quite clear that if they want him to keep supporting the program, they better start winning.
